Files
server/core/lib/Service/TenantService.php
2026-02-19 00:18:32 -05:00

25 lines
465 B
PHP

<?php
namespace KTXC\Service;
use KTXC\Models\Tenant\TenantObject;
use KTXC\Stores\TenantStore;
class TenantService
{
public function __construct(protected readonly TenantStore $store)
{
}
public function fetchByDomain(string $domain): ?TenantObject
{
return $this->store->fetchByDomain($domain);
}
public function fetchById(string $identifier): ?TenantObject
{
return $this->store->fetch($identifier);
}
}